These are the 1917 editions but include information on cars and trucks from their earlier editions (1909, 1910, 1912, 1915, 1916). Each book measures about 8" by 6" and each contains about 300 pages. The mechanical features of virtually every make of pre-1917 automobiles are discussed in great length ranging Model Ts to Locomobiles (and everything in between!) as well as accessories, etc. There are hundreds of drawings, illustration plates and engraving plates throughout. This complete five volume set has an incredible wealth of automotive information. These were published by the American Technical Society of Chicago. Included in this set are: Volume 1 : Motors, welding, valve gears, carburetors, transmissions Volume 2: Chassis, running gear, driving, road troubles, repairs Volume 3: Ignition, Starting, Lighting, Wiring Diagrams, Motorcycles Volume 4: Electrics, Storage cells, Repairs, Steam Cars, Motorboats Volume 5: Delivery cars, Trucks, Tractors, Special Cars, Index These appear to have leather covers.
